HL Deb 19 June 1998 vol 590 c155WA
Lord Kennet

asked Her Majesty's Government:

Whether they will make a greater effort to persuade the European Commission to allow the discontinuance of VAT at high-rate on repairs to listed buildings, to avoid degradation of those buildings. [HL2192]

Lord McIntosh of Haringey

The Government have no plans to pursue with the European Commission any changes to the rate of VAT on repairs to listed buildings. We believe that the maintenance and preservation of our built heritage is a most worthy cause and support is already given by way of grants.
